Shinobi/web/pages/blocks/superPluginManager.ejs

44 lines
2.2 KiB
Plaintext

<div class="row">
<div class="col-md-6">
<div class="card bg-dark grey mt-1">
<div class="card-header">
<%- lang['Plugin Manager'] %>
</div>
<ul class="nav nav-tabs nav-tabs-neutral justify-content-center bg-dark" id="tablist" role="tablist">
<li class="nav-item">
<a class="nav-link active" data-bs-toggle="tab" data-bs-target="#pluginManagerList" role="tab"><%-lang['Downloaded']%></a>
</li>
<li class="nav-item">
<a class="nav-link" data-bs-toggle="tab" data-bs-target="#pluginManagerDownloadbleList" role="tab"><%-lang['Download Plugins']%></a>
</li>
</ul>
</div>
</div>
<div class="col-md-6">
<form class="card bg-dark grey mt-1" id="downloadNewPlugin">
<div class="card-body">
<div class="form-group">
<input type="text" placeholder="<%- lang['Download URL for Module'] %> (.zip)" class="form-control" name="downloadUrl" />
</div>
<div class="form-group">
<input type="text" placeholder="<%- lang['Subdirectory for Module'] %> (<%- lang['Inside the downloaded package'] %>)" class="form-control" name="packageRoot" />
</div>
<div><button type="submit" class="btn btn-round btn-block btn-default mb-0"><i class="fa fa-download"></i> <%- lang.Download %></button></div>
</div>
</form>
</div>
</div>
<div class="tab-content pt-4 pb-0 m-0">
<div class="tab-pane active" id="pluginManagerList"></div>
<div class="tab-pane" id="pluginManagerDownloadbleList">
<div class="form-group">
<input id="pluginManagerDownloadbleListSearch" type="text" placeholder="<%- lang.Search %>" class="form-control" />
</div>
<table class="table table-striped" id="pluginManagerDownloadble">
<tbody></tbody>
</table>
</div>
</div>
<link rel="stylesheet" href="<%-window.libURL%>assets/css/super.pluginManager.css">
<script src="<%-window.libURL%>assets/js/super.pluginManager.js" type="text/javascript"></script>